Avery Pennarun
|
b4d04a065f
|
controlclient: extract a Client interface and rename Client->Auto.
This will let us create a mock or fake Client implementation for use
with ipn.Backend.
Signed-off-by: Avery Pennarun <apenwarr@tailscale.com>
|
2021-04-30 00:09:35 -04:00 |
|
Denton Gentry
|
b716c76df9
|
cover one more case in TestStatusEqual.
Signed-off-by: Denton Gentry <dgentry@tailscale.com>
|
2021-01-08 10:23:32 -08:00 |
|
Brad Fitzpatrick
|
cd21ba0a71
|
tailcfg, control/controlclient: add GoArch, populate OSVersion on Linux
|
2020-07-27 21:14:28 -07:00 |
|
David Anderson
|
557b310e67
|
control/controlclient: move auto_test back to corp repo.
It can't run without corp stuff anyway, and makes it harder to
refactor the control server.
|
2020-05-27 19:08:21 +00:00 |
|
Brad Fitzpatrick
|
fefd7e10dc
|
types/structs: add structs.Incomparable annotation, use it where applicable
Shotizam before and output queries:
sqlite> select sum(size) from bin where func like 'type..%';
129067
=>
120216
|
2020-05-03 14:05:32 -07:00 |
|
Brad Fitzpatrick
|
747c7d7ce2
|
types/empty: add Message, stop using mysterious *struct{}
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
|
2020-02-14 13:35:49 -08:00 |
|
Earl Lee
|
a8d8b8719a
|
Move Linux client & common packages into a public repo.
|
2020-02-09 09:32:57 -08:00 |
|